We visit Pull&Bear and Bershka at the Bullring in Birmingham as the fasion stores open: what we found there

Zara’s parent company has opened fashion stores Bershka and Pull&Bear in Birmingham’s Bullring as they bring the latest streetwear trends to Brummies

It’s almost Christmas and people are rushing to get their festive shopping done in time. Bullring and Grand Central are one of the top destinations along with Birmingham High Street and New Street to grab some of the latest fashions, trinkets and stocking fillers for our near and dear ones. 

One of the best experiences of visiting the shopping centres in the city centre are the amazing events, lights and decor to fill us with festive spirit. And, the Bullring shopping centre has upped its game with three major openings this week. 

Goldsmiths reopened after an expansion on Monday while Spain’s global fashion retailers - Pull&Bear and Bershka opened today (Thursday, December 7). 

The popular streetwear brands, owned by Inditex, have taken up a 36,453sq ft unit, separated by two dedicated entrances, located on Bullring & Grand Central’s upper level next to River Island. Inditex also owns the brands Zara, Massimo Dutti, Stradivarius, Oysho and Zara Home. 

We visited the two newly opened stores and found the best of casual streetwear fashion at the brick and mortar stores. 

The Christmas shoppers have already descended on the newly opened stores - which have a mix of trendy clothes that are perfect for Winter 2023/2024.

While browsing through the shelves at the two bright and shiny outlets, it was obvious that the brands are perfect for a young audience and there were plenty of groups of young men and women exploring the stores. 

Pull&Bear sports a silver and white look giving off a glam look. They are equipped with self-checkout counters, fitting rooms, as well as manned checkout counters. If anyone is looking for the best selfie spot, the brightly lit silver stairs with blue walls leading up to the upper floor - where the men’s collection is displayed - is the perfect place. 

It gives the feeling of walking up a tunnel and opens into the brightly lit first floor. The winter collection is full of chic jackets and coats, dresses perfect for parties, as well as comfy hoodies and oversized shirts for both men and women. 

Next door, Bershka sports a more colourful theme with red walls and a more open floor plan. Helpful and friendly staff were everywhere to assist customers. They also have a good collection for stylish teens and young adults. 

Cut-out dresses, faux leather jackets, as well as coats and trousers lined the shelves at Bershka. They also have something for those who are more adventurous in their fashion choices. 

Bullring is also home to global fast fashion leader Inditex’s Zara located on New Street.
